GUE/NGL, the Left political group at the European Parliament, has announced the results by consensus of its newly-elected presidium with Gabi Zimmer (Germany) remaining as the group's President. 

MEPs elected also Tania González Peñas and Marina Albiol (Spain) – on a shared post arrangement – as well as Dennis de Jong (Netherlands), and re-elected Neoklis Sylikiotis (Cyprus) and Patrick Le Hyaric (France) as group vice-Presidents. 

GUE/NGL warmly thanks Malin Björk (Sweden) who served as the group’s vice-President for the first half of this legislature.

At its first meeting today, the presidium reaffirmed the candidacy of Eleonora Forenza (Italy) for the upcoming European Parliament's presidency elections and the nomination of Dimitrios Papadimoulis (Greece) as the group’s candidate for the vice-President post. 

Commenting on the election process, GUE/NGL President Gabi Zimmer said:

“The European Parliament must be a place for democracy and pluralism. We want the diverse views and aspirations of European citizens to be represented in the Parliament through full participation of MEPs and political groups. The Parliament must not be owned by the biggest groups alone.”
